NOTE
In case you prefer to use complete drivers instead of single telegrams, the following
options are availabe:
C++ drivers:
https://github.com/SICKAG/sick_scan_xd
ROS drivers:
https://github.com/SICKAG/sick_scan_xd
ROS2 drivers:
https://github.com/SICKAG/sick_scan_xd
NOTE
Telegrams that are not described in this document for the device should not be imple‐
mented as they may either be incompetible or cause undesired effects.
NOTE
CoLa 2 is a SICK specific communication protocol which is used for communication
between SICK devices and SICK specific tools and services only.
